Warrington West boasts an array of facilities designed to enhance your journey. For ticket purchases, the station is equipped with a ticket office open from 06:00 to 00:10 on weekdays and a little shorter on Sundays. If you plan to collect pre-purchased tickets, worry not—the station has ticket machines ready for use, including accessible ones for those who need it. Travelers with hearing impairments will be pleased to know that induction loops are available.

Cholsey station ensures a pleasant journey with a variety of services designed to cater to different needs. Ticket buying is seamless with a ticket office open from early morning until after midday on weekdays and weekends, along with accessible ticket machines for those in a hurry. Passengers who purchase their tickets online can collect them with ease from these machines.
For those seeking information or assistance, staff are available during office hours, and both help points and departure screens keep travelers informed. Although there aren't any luggage storage facilities or extensive lounge amenities, the station compensates with essentials like seating areas and waiting rooms. Note that it doesn’t offer step-free access, so travelers with mobility impairments may require additional assistance.
